Department Of Labor Revises Joint Employment Regulations
On January 12, 2020 the Department of Labor (DOL) announced a final rule revising its regulations on joint employment under the Fair Labor Standards Act (FLSA). The new rule provides guidance for determining joint employer status when an employee...
